I'm inside a GRASS session, with my Windows GRASS Command Line and I try to run a python script using GRASS functions:

import os
import grass.script as grass
env = grass.gisenv()
print env
r = grass.read_command("g.list", type='vect')
print r


GRASS 6.4.0svn (YzeronEPSG)> E:\pythoninput\test_simple.py

Output:

Traceback (most recent call last):
 File "E:\pythoninput\test_simple.py", line 2, in <module>
   import grass.script as grass
File "C:\GRASS-4-SVN\etc\python\grass\script\__init__.py", line 1, in <module>

   from core   import *
File "C:\GRASS-4-SVN\etc\python\grass\script\core.py", line 30, in <module>
   import subprocess
 File "C:\GRASS-4-SVN\Python25\lib\subprocess.py", line 376, in <module>
   import threading
 File "C:\GRASS-4-SVN\Python25\lib\threading.py", line 13, in <module>
   from collections import deque
ImportError: No module named collections


Is this an error in the PYTHONPATH? And where can I define it inside GRASS?
